Prospective Evaluation of the Prognostic Impact of Measurable Residual Disease (MRD) Within a Phase III Study Comparing a Fixed Duration Therapy Versus Continuous Therapy With Daratumumab, Lenalidomide, and Dexamethasone for Relapsed Multiple Myeloma Requiring a First Salvage Treatment.

Condition: Multiple Myeloma  ·  Sponsor: Assistance Publique - Hôpitaux de Paris

PhaseN/A
Planned participants260
Who can joinAll sexes, 18 Years to no upper limit
Healthy volunteersNo

About this study

We propose to conduct an ancillary prospective evaluation of the impact of Dara-Len-Dex discontinuation after 2 years, on the persistence of MRD negativity in patients that were MRD negative at 2 years.
